Emmaus, Pennsylvania, U. S. A.: Rodale Pr, 1995. 1st Edition 1st Printing. Hardcover. Near Fine. 4to - over 9¾ - 12" tall. First Edition/First Printing (The One Is Present In The Number Line). Includes Woodworking Glossary And Index. Blue Laminated Pictorial Boards With White Lettering And Rule On The Spine. Light Rubbing.
